Laser Distance Measuring Equipment
Laser Ranging Retroreflector (LRRR)
- Deployed on Apollo missions
- Consists of corner reflectors for measuring distances
- Laser beams bounced off the retroreflector for distance measurement
- A faint return signal, precise timing, and usage of individual photons for detection
- Used in construction for precise layout and measurements
Hilti PD-E
- Best for easy, fast measurements with great visibility
- Expensive at $1500+tax
- Recommended for accurate and efficient measurements
Leica DISTO D2
- Known for precision and range
- Utilizes a red laser with advanced optics for visibility, especially in daylight
- Bluetooth connectivity for seamless integration with digital applications
Bosch GLM 50-27 C
- Green laser makes it more visible in bright conditions
- Compact design for portability
- Bluetooth connectivity for data transfer to smartphones
Other Products
- Bosch GLM400CL: Reasonable price, does 90% of tasks efficiently
- iPhone Measure App: Quick and accurate measurements, especially for budget-friendly options
- Leica X4: Boots up fast, has a digital camera for zooming, and performs well even in bright conditions
